Output de33ebd104a7c313d1fe0337c096c791488965510c84c3a01dc3086e4adf810c:1

value
1003200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8db89818a3bc36ede90f490e2485b05ef7b316 OP_EQUAL
address
37DCF1K8kT52nx2u77kchNNuaLd89Wqb4E
transaction
de33ebd104a7c313d1fe0337c096c791488965510c84c3a01dc3086e4adf810c
spent
true